Unspecified impact via invalid AMDGPU mapping ranges
Published Apr 23, 2024 · Updated Aug 5, 2026
Improper input validation in the Linux kernel AMDGPU VM code allows local users to trigger unspecified impact through GPU mapping ioctls. The amdgpu_vm_bo_map, amdgpu_vm_bo_replace_map, and amdgpu_vm_bo_clear_mappings paths inconsistently accept unaligned, zero-length, overflowing, object-out-of-bounds, or maximum-PFN-exceeding ranges. Reachability requires local access to an AMDGPU DRM device node, and upstream has not published the resulting failure mode.
